掃二維碼與項目經(jīng)理溝通
我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流
Redis緩存文件存放之處

站在用戶的角度思考問題,與客戶深入溝通,找到克東網(wǎng)站設(shè)計與克東網(wǎng)站推廣的解決方案,憑借多年的經(jīng)驗,讓設(shè)計與互聯(lián)網(wǎng)技術(shù)結(jié)合,創(chuàng)造個性化、用戶體驗好的作品,建站類型包括:網(wǎng)站設(shè)計、成都做網(wǎng)站、企業(yè)官網(wǎng)、英文網(wǎng)站、手機端網(wǎng)站、網(wǎng)站推廣、域名申請、網(wǎng)頁空間、企業(yè)郵箱。業(yè)務(wù)覆蓋克東地區(qū)。
在開發(fā)過程中,緩存技術(shù)可以提高系統(tǒng)的響應(yīng)速度和性能。而Redis是一個廣泛使用的緩存系統(tǒng),其高效的讀寫速度和大容量的數(shù)據(jù)存儲能力讓其在企業(yè)級應(yīng)用中得到廣泛應(yīng)用。在使用Redis緩存的過程中,存儲文件是必不可少的一部分,下面我們來看一下Redis緩存文件存放的具體方式。
Redis的緩存文件默認存儲路徑在服務(wù)器的根目錄下,但是這個路徑存在較多的隱患,因此我們建議將文件存儲到一個獨立的目錄下。首先需要創(chuàng)建一個新的目錄,然后可以使用以下命令修改Redis的配置文件,指定該目錄作為文件存儲路徑。
vi /etc/redis/redis.conf
然后找到以下內(nèi)容:
dir /var/lib/redis
將其修改為:
dir /path/to/new/directory
在完成配置文件的修改后,需要重新啟動Redis服務(wù)使配置文件生效:
systemctl restart redis
此時Redis緩存文件將存儲在指定路徑中。
另外,如果在Redis的配置文件中開啟了RDB(Redis Database Backup)持久化機制,那么Redis在指定時間間隔內(nèi)會將內(nèi)存中的數(shù)據(jù)保存到磁盤中。默認情況下,RDB文件同樣保存在Redis的根目錄下,我們同樣建議將其設(shè)置到一個獨立的目錄下。
在Redis配置文件中找到以下內(nèi)容:
save 900 1
save 300 10
save 60 10000
其中save表示持久化的時間周期,900、300、60表示時間間隔(秒),1、10、10000表示滿足條件后需要持久化的操作次數(shù)。我們需要在這之后添加一條命令,直接指定RDB持久化文件的存儲路徑。
dbfilename redis.rdb
dir /path/to/new/directory
同樣,完成配置文件的修改后需要重啟Redis服務(wù)以使其生效。
總結(jié)
在使用Redis緩存數(shù)據(jù)的時候,存儲文件的存儲位置需要進行合理的規(guī)劃和設(shè)置。如果存儲在隨意的路徑下可能會引起一些風(fēng)險和安全問題。因此,我們建議將Redis緩存文件和RDB持久化文件都存儲在獨立的目錄下,以便對其進行更好的管理和保管。通過以上介紹,相信大家對Redis緩存文件存放位置有了更為清晰的認識。
成都服務(wù)器托管選創(chuàng)新互聯(lián),先上架開通再付費。
創(chuàng)新互聯(lián)(www.cdcxhl.com)專業(yè)-網(wǎng)站建設(shè),軟件開發(fā)老牌服務(wù)商!微信小程序開發(fā),APP開發(fā),網(wǎng)站制作,網(wǎng)站營銷推廣服務(wù)眾多企業(yè)。電話:028-86922220

我們在微信上24小時期待你的聲音
解答本文疑問/技術(shù)咨詢/運營咨詢/技術(shù)建議/互聯(lián)網(wǎng)交流